Cats: Pesan kesalahan yang lebih baik untuk implikasi yang hilang

Dibuat pada 22 Okt 2015  ·  3Komentar  ·  Sumber: typelevel/cats

Banyak pendatang baru lupa mengimpor contoh implisit (mis. cats.implicits._ ) yang menyebabkan banyak kesulitan.

Mungkin bagus jika ketika Functor[X] tidak ditemukan, pesan tersebut menunjukkan bahwa Anda mungkin gagal mengimpornya (dan bahkan dapat menyebutkan cats.std.all._ atau cats.implicits._ ).

Apa yang kalian pikirkan?

enhancement help wanted question

Komentar yang paling membantu

Saya baru saja melakukan PR di Simulacrum (dengan bantuan dari @larsrh): https://github.com/typelevel/simulacrum/pull/144

Semua 3 komentar

(Bagian buruknya di sini adalah saya pikir ini akan membutuhkan anotasi setiap jenis kelas dengan beberapa jenis pesan. Entah itu, atau menghubungkannya ke Simulacrum entah bagaimana.)

+1 besar untuk pemasangan kabel di Simulacrum.

Saya baru saja melakukan PR di Simulacrum (dengan bantuan dari @larsrh): https://github.com/typelevel/simulacrum/pull/144

Apakah halaman ini membantu?
0 / 5 - 0 peringkat